After failing to score a single touchdown in each of his last three games, Eli Manning came out firing in Week 12 against the Packers. Through nearly two quarters of play, he’s completed 8 of 15 passes for 132 yards and two touchdowns.

The Packers’ secondary is basically letting Manning do whatever he wants, while Aaron Rodgers is surprisingly struggling to finish some drives.
Fantasy Impact: Three scoreless weeks would likely deter a lot of owners. If you remained faithful to Manning this week, it looks like it’s going to pay off. Who really expected him to be shutout for a fourth straight week?
Assuming Green Bay keeps it close, Manning will keep throwing the ball often throughout the night. The Giants don’t want a repeat of Rodgers’ soul-crushing comeback from last season.
